Subtract 90/28 from 54/14
1st number: 3 12/14, 2nd number: 3 6/28
54/14 - 90/28 is 9/14.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 14 and 28 is 28
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 28 - For the 1st fraction, since 14 × 2 = 28,
54/14 = 54 × 2/14 × 2 = 108/28 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 1 = 28,
90/28 = 90 × 1/28 × 1 = 90/28 - Subtract the two like fractions:
108/28 - 90/28 = 108 - 90/28 = 18/28 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 9/14
